Webb1 jan. 2011 · Susan Eloise Hinton was born in Tulsa, Oklahoma. She has always enjoyed reading but wasn't satisfied with the literature that was being written for young adults, which influenced her to write novels like The Outsiders. That book, her first novel, was published in 1967 by Viking.
Webb19 juli 2007 · S. E. Hinton wrote her first book, The Outsiders, in 1967, when she was seventeen years old. She graduated from the University of Tulsa in 1970, with a degree in education. The following year, she married a fellow student, David. They have one son and live in Tulsa. Also by S.E.
